The Role:

Coordinates all supply chain activities; determines purchasing feasibility, cost effectiveness, and customer demand for new and existing products. Anticipates possible price changes, based on industry knowledge; surveys markets for the best source, negotiates most favorable proposals.

Develops the purchasing arrangement for commodities, including contracts, blanket orders, one-time purchases and vendor stocking programs.

Focused on Supplier quality: Ensures suppliers meet our quality standards, meeting all requirements in quantity, quality and delivery, working with vendors for improvement as required and participates in the Management Review reporting on this corporate objective.

Essential Functions:

  • Coordinates daily activities of the Procurement Department.
  • Surveys markets for the best source, negotiates most favorable proposals
  • Improves efficiency and cost savings of the department
  • Evaluates supplier performance based on knowledge of prices, deliveries and service
  • Ensures critical vendors are compliant with our vendor quality requirements for quantity, quality and delivery
  • Handles the administrative aspects of supplier non-conforming material, including disposition and communication with other departments involved. Follows it through to closure in a timely manner.
  • Participates in the MRB to determine a timely and cost-effective resolution on all matters
  • Develops the most suitable purchasing arrangement for commodities, including contracts, blanket orders, one-time purchases and vendor stocking programs
  • Determine purchasing feasibility, cost effectiveness, and customer demand for new and existing products. Anticipating possible price changes, based on industry knowledge
  • Completes quote requests in a timely manner and follow up as needed to ensure compliance. Analyzes and checks for pricing, quality and delivery requirements.
  • Manages the slow-moving inventory and inventory write-off programs coordinating with accounting, sales, engineering, operations and the warehouse
  • Maintains the Departmental Training Manual, revising processes as they change. Determines work procedures, prepares work schedules, and expedites workflow
  • Participates or leads vendor audits, managing the administrative aspects
  • Confirm / expedite open Purchase Orders to ensure timely delivery to meet Production schedule.
  • Maintain supplier confirmed delivery dates in VM accurately to ensure Production schedule is met.


Experience & Education:

  • Bachelor’s degree with a minimum of five years of recent and relevant business experience in a manufacturing environment preferred. Two additional years of relevant experience may be substituted for degree.
  • Experience with product data management and configuration management processes 
  • Advanced organizational abilities, oral & written communications and interpersonal skills are mandatory. Continuous updates and timely feedback/follow-thru on all assigned tasks required.
  • Demonstrate superior ability to perform job with minimal supervision. 
  • Analyze and resolve moderately complex problems, demonstrated experience with root cause analysis for problem solving.
  • ERP/MRP system experience as a user. Syspro experience strongly preferred.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ications, with excellent Excel skills.
  • Electronic and mechanical component purchasing experience.
  • Demonstrated knowledge of purchasing, inventory control, and manufacturing processes
  • Product Lifecycle Management system experience
  • Candidates must have experience with ISO regulations and procurement reporting systems. 
  • APICS certification is a definite plus.
